Virack Chhom

We shared the small party tray and it came to under $50 including tax (table of 2 people). As salmon lovers, the party tray was delicious! Plenty of salmon pieces. The salmon sashimi had a perfect ratio of lean to fatty meat and were of a good thickness. The spicy salmon rolls tasted fresh and had a very dry nice crunch to them, which we liked.The sushi chef and the other cook/waitress were jolly and welcoming. The restaurant is a cozy warm place, tucked away in the corner of a busy plaza. Hours are shorter than the rest of the establishments in the plaza, but it’s worth it to eat here! Payment was cash only when we were there.Great place, definitely worth a try!(Picture is after we had already dug into several few pieces of the sushi, we couldn’t wait haha)

Imelda M.

Daon Sushi has been on my radar for a long time. I was in the area looking for a fast food lunch and walked in to order a bento box. The nice owner lady served me hot tea to start. She was very sweet and polite. Shortly afterward the man behind the counter served me a small bowl of hot miso soup which had a good amount of green onions. It was the proper proportion of miso to water too; not watery like other restaurants. It was tasty. Within a short period of time my bento box arrived. It consisted of a crunchy vegetable spring roll, crispy iceberg salad with shreds of carrot, edamame, rice and teriyaki glazed salmon sprinkled with sesame seeds, green onions, sitting atop a bed of stir fried cabbage. I'd say it was better than the alternative for a fast food meal.
